Detailed Comparison

Design Control

Webflow

Webflow

Webflow gives pixel-perfect design control through a visual CSS editor. Build any design without code. Responsive design with visual breakpoint editing. Professional results without developers.


WordPress

WordPress design depends on your theme. Page builders (Elementor, Divi) offer visual editing but add bloat. Custom themes require PHP development. Less design freedom without coding.

Content Management

WordPress

Webflow

Webflow CMS is structured and clean - custom collections with defined fields. Great for blogs, portfolios, and structured content. Limited to 10,000 items on most plans.


WordPress

WordPress CMS is the most mature in the world - custom post types, taxonomies, and the block editor. Handles millions of posts. The content management benchmark.

Hosting & Performance

Webflow

Webflow

Webflow hosting is included - fast CDN, automatic SSL, and no server management. Performance is consistently good without optimization effort. But you must host on Webflow.


WordPress

WordPress hosting varies widely - from cheap shared hosting to premium managed hosts. Performance depends entirely on your host, theme, and plugins. More control but more responsibility.

Plugins & Extensibility

WordPress

Webflow

Webflow has a growing but limited app marketplace. Custom code embeds and integrations exist but there is no plugin ecosystem comparable to WordPress. Custom functionality requires external tools.


WordPress

WordPress has 60,000+ plugins for virtually any feature - SEO, e-commerce, forms, memberships, LMS, and more. The plugin ecosystem is its biggest strength and biggest weakness (security, bloat).

SEO

WordPress

Webflow

Webflow generates clean, semantic HTML. Built-in meta fields, auto-generated sitemaps, clean URLs. Good core SEO without plugins. Limited advanced SEO customization.


WordPress

WordPress with Yoast or Rank Math provides the most comprehensive SEO toolset available. Schema markup, XML sitemaps, breadcrumbs, and advanced meta control. The SEO standard.

The Verdict

Choose Webflow if you want a visually designed, high-performance website without managing hosting, plugins, or security. Best for marketing sites, portfolios, and businesses that value design quality. Choose WordPress if you need maximum extensibility, a mature CMS for large content libraries, or specific plugin functionality. For simple to mid-complexity business websites, Webflow delivers better results with less maintenance.
